The NFL is working through the Week 7 schedule, but in the meantime, we've got some early odds to get you ready for Week 8. The Cincinnati Bengals and Cleveland Browns will face off this coming week, with kickoff set for 8:15 p.m. ET on Monday, October 31.

The Bengals (4-3) had a huge day against the Atlanta Falcons. They did not allow a score in the second half, which has become a regular occurrence for this Cincinnati team, and QB Joe Burrow passed for a whopping 481 yards and three touchdowns, spreading the ball out to his talented receiving corps.

The Browns (2-5) dropped a close one to the Ravens on Sunday. They couldn't hold onto the ball, turning it over twice on fumbles. Nick Chubb had a solid day in the backfield, and it came down to a final drive, but Cleveland is now on a four-game losing streak.
